A Pair Of Silver Serving Spoons Plain With A Engraved And pierced Handle.
A pair of silver serving spoons made in Sheffield and Hallmarked in 1905. The spoons are in their original box with a silk and velvet Blue lining. The handles are pierced with flowers and engraved with leaves and swearls. The spoons are plain on the bowl and plain on the backs with a hallmark on the handle. The spoons where retailed by Mappin and Webb but made by Roberts and Belk.
Condition: Very good.
Dimensions
Width: Bowl 5.5 cms, Hndle at the widest point 2.3 cms.
Length: 21.5 cms.
Weight: per spoon 59 grams.
